
Pittsburgh Shakespeare in the Parks
Celebrating its 18th season in 2022, Pittsburgh Shakespeare in the Parks' brings accessible, high-quality, free Shakespeare to fans of all ages through live performances in Pittsburgh parks and our first live indoor production.
PSIP has performed outdoors since 2005. The troupe encourages the enjoyment and preservation of our natural public places and parks. Each autumn, the company presents one play during four weekend afternoons. In 2021, several evening events were added to the schedule which totaled a record 11 performances.
Admission is free, with donations encouraged. Audience members are invited to bring chairs, blankets, picnics, and anything permitted in Pittsburgh city parks. The performances often include an additional pre-show performance and the plays run for about 1.5 hours with no intermission.
